Electric Buses and Last-Mile Connectivity Solutions

Electric buses are emerging as a cornerstone of sustainable urban transport, addressing both environmental concerns and mobility challenges. As cities evolve toward cleaner and smarter mobility, electric buses—paired with effective last-mile connectivity solutions—are redefining how people move across urban landscapes. This integration not only reduces carbon emissions but also ensures smoother, more efficient travel for millions of commuters.

Driving Sustainable Urban Transport
Electric buses offer a cleaner, quieter, and more efficient alternative to traditional diesel-powered public transport. Powered by renewable energy sources, they significantly cut greenhouse gas emissions and improve air quality in densely populated cities. Governments and transport authorities are investing heavily in EV bus fleets, supported by smart charging infrastructure and digital management systems that optimize energy use, route planning, and fleet maintenance. These buses are helping cities move closer to their net-zero emission goals while ensuring reliable mass transit.

Bridging the Last-Mile Gap


Last-mile connectivity remains one of the biggest challenges in public transportation. Electric mobility solutions such as e-rickshaws, e-scooters, and small shuttle EVs are now bridging this crucial gap between major transport hubs and passengers’ final destinations. By integrating electric buses with these last-mile options, cities can create a seamless and connected transport network. Smart ticketing systems and mobile apps further enhance convenience, allowing commuters to plan entire journeys—from bus rides to last-mile transfers—through unified platforms.

Smart Infrastructure and Policy Support
The success of electric buses and last-mile connectivity depends on robust infrastructure and strong policy support. Cities are building smart charging depots, renewable-powered bus terminals, and dedicated EV lanes to improve efficiency. Government incentives, subsidies, and public-private partnerships are accelerating adoption across India and globally. When combined with data-driven traffic management and IoT-based monitoring, these initiatives ensure a reliable, safe, and energy-efficient urban mobility ecosystem.
